Workshop on Nuclear Security | On October 13, 2011, in Hanoi Vietnam Agency for Radiation and Nuclear Safety (VARANS) coordinated with Japanese Atomic Energy Agency (JAEA) to organize the Workshop on Nuclear Security. Doctor Le Chi Dung– VARANS’ Deputy Director attended and made the opening speech at the Workshop. | |

Participating in the Workshop were experts of IAEA, Japan, the US and representatives from Ministry of Police, Ministry of Foreign Affairs, Ministry of Defence, VARANS, Vietnam Atomic Energy Commission, Department of Atomic Energy.
Making the opening speech, Deputy Director Le Chi Dung emphasized in the current global situation, nuclear security has become a global issue which needs to have the attention and cooperation of the international community. With the commitment to use nuclear for peaceful purpose, Vietnamhas always made efforts in assuring nuclear security. The Deputy Director recognized the fact that the Workshop on Nuclear Security was organized at the point of time was very useful because it was the time for improving the legal basis to introduce nuclear power in Vietnam in 2020.
In the Workshop, experts presented international nuclear mechanisms, Treaty on Nuclear Entity Protection and Amendment (the Treaty) and current tendency on nuclear security. Japanese experts also introduced about the process of introducing international nuclear requirements into Japanese legal framework, Japanese efforts in introducing the Treaty’s requirements into the national system and Japanese policies on nuclear security in the current context.
The Workshop was a good opportunity to share information and experience with experts of IAEA, the US and Japan in the international nuclear security mechanism and then its effective application in the development and improvement of Vietnam’s nuclear security mechanism.
